Fe scheme 1
Notes
Ionization scheme developed by Trappitsch et al. using the CHILI instrument. Additional wavelength scans are published in the PhD thesis.
Scheme
Ionization Potential: 63737.704 cm⁻¹ (NIST ASD, 2024)
Lasers used: Ti:Sa
Scheme table
| Step | λ (nm) | From (cm⁻¹) | Term | To (cm⁻¹) | Term |
|---|---|---|---|---|---|
| 1 | 382.553 | 0.000 | 5D4 | 26140.196 | 5D3 |
| 2 | 409.993 | 26140.196 | 5D3 | 50530.829 | 5D3 |
| 3 | 735.554 | 50530.829 | 5D3 | 64126.024 | AI |
